500 000 Zaïres

Features

Issuer Democratic Republic of the CongoZaire (1971-1997)
Issuing bank Bank of Zaire
Period Republic (1971-1997)
Type Standard banknote
Year 1992
Value 500 000 Zaïres (500 000 ZRZ)
Currency Zaire (1967-1993)
Composition Paper
Size 159 × 76 mm
Shape Rectangular
Demonetized 26 November 1993

Obverse

Mobutu Sese Seko in military uniform on the right
leopard in bottom left face
Coat of arms in botton right corner

Script: Latin

Lettering:
BANQUE DU ZAÏRE
CINQ CENT MILLE ZAÏRES
500000

Reverse

Inga Hydroelectric dam, center left

Script: Latin

Lettering:
LE CONTREFACTEUR EST PUNI DE SERVITUDE PENALE
500000
BANQUE DU ZAÏRE 500000

Watermark

Mobutu Sese Seko

Printer

Giesecke+Devrient (Giesecke & Devrient), Leipzig, Germany (1852-date)
